Magnus Ek (born 1994)[1] is a Swedish politician. As of 24 September 2018, he serves as Member of the Riksdag representing the constituency of Östergötland County.[2] He was chairman of the Centre Party Youth from 2015 to 2019.[3]

Personal life[]

His mother Lena Ek is a former politician. She served as Minister for the Environment from 2011 to 2014.
